TGS Baltic has advised UAB XXT, which is controlled by UAB M.M.M. Projektai, on the sale of the S7 office complex to Eastnine. Sorainen advised Eastnine on the acquisition.

S7 is located in Zverynas, one of the oldest neighborhoods in Vilnius. The complex consists of four buildings. Based on the agreement between XXT and Eastnine, the latter will acquire three buildings in the S7 complex, totaling 42,500 square meters.  

According to Sorainen's press release, the acquisition of the first business center was completed in February 2019. The acquisition of the second and third business centers is planned for the end of the second and fourth quarters of 2019.

The transaction value was EUR 128.3 million, which according to TGS Baltic is a record transaction in the office segment in the Baltic States and by far the largest acquisition of commercial real estate in recent years.

UAB M.M.M. Projektai is a real estate development and management company operating in Central and Eastern Europe that is owned by UAB Vilniaus Prekyba. 

Eastnine is a Swedish investment company that is a major investor in office buildings in the Baltics. Eastnine’s shares are listed on the Stockholm Stock Exchange.
